There are hotels that dont offer TV in their rooms. And this could be a beginning of a new trend.

Some owners think that their guests much rather would enjoy the breath-taking views from their bedroom. Others think that rooms without TV promote deep rest.

Many hotels now offer complimentary in-room Wi-Fi (in public spaces) so there is ample opportunity to watch content in the comfort of your room without a TV.

However,observations from hoteliers on guest behaviour suggests content consumption isnt as commonplace as you might expect.
